Boarding College Vs . Other Options
Things you should think about and compare: Depending on in your geographical area, local schooling options can easily compare to boarding schools in many ways. Nearby private day schools, magnet schools, or maybe public high schools can easily naturally have very vibrant student bodies and experienced faculty. Academic and extracurricular offerings can also be equally challenging and diverse. If you're thinking about local options besides boarding school, compare these crucial considerations:
Attention to students -- boarding schools generally have small class sizes in which help teachers engage every student in the classroom. Classroom settings are often specifically designed to inspire student participation and eyes contact among everyone in the lecture. Quality of faculty - virtually all boarding school faculty get advanced degrees in often education or another specialty.
Top quality of resources - college student resources at boarding schools - such as the library, show facilities, or athletic complexes - can often be superior relative to local options.
Challenging educational instruction - academics at boarding schools operate at substantial standards. Students are forced to "ask why, very well become inquisitive, and deal with challenging problems.
Broad along with diverse offerings - program selections at boarding educational facilities tend to be quite diverse, get plenty of AP options, and gives a wide range of topics. Athletic along with extracurricular options tend to be wide-ranging as well, which encourage students to try new things. Many boarding schools also offer to be able to study in different countries for any term.
College counseling -- college counseling departments in boarding schools are generally well-staffed and taken quite really. Counselors often have plenty of practical experience in helping applicants identify suitable schools and advising these individuals on getting-in at competitive institutions.
Benefits unique to help boarding school:
In other methods, however , you'll find that boarding universities are strictly unique. With your boarding school research, you will likely hear that "boarding school is an education in and also itself. " While a little bit corny, the phrase holds true - living in a boarding school community leads to mastering that is just as (or more) valuable than the education you receive strictly in a classroom. Boarding school alumni say that they already have really liked:
Making choices that matter and having responsibility for yourself - living on your own isn't always quick. There is, of course , plenty of help from faculty, advisors and peers. But still, you need to take attention of yourself and have responsibility for your own actions into a much greater degree than in case you were living at home. Even though there's definitely structure from the boarding school day, you continue to need to make choices all-around how you spend your time, what activities and opportunities to take, and the way to create a reasonable balance in between work and play. You are allowed to make choices that have a on-site impact on the things you learn and also the life you lead with boarding school. For parents: this specific roughly translates to increased maturation, greater self-sufficiency, and excellent preparation for college.

Having a lot of fun and building intense friendships - boarding school can also be a lot of fun. Picture living in a house with a couple of your best friends. It's widespread in boarding school for ones dorm mates to become your closest friends and help. The friendships that you help make in this environment will be ones you will remember for life. Having a wide range of friends - boarding schools actively aim to generate prospects students from a wide range of geographic, racial, and socio-economic backdrops. Many schools have college students coming from all over the United States and dozens of different countries. On boarding schools, you'll be come across a relatively wide range of individuals as well as cultures, whereas local possibilities may expose you to any narrower background of scholars.
Having faculty as buddies and having them regularly obtainable - students are exposed to teachers in plenty of settings during the day - e. g., often the classroom (as teachers), casual fields (as coaches), after school groups (as advisors), as well as dorm settings (as dorm supervisors). Since faculty usually are accessible throughout the day, getting school help is usually a lot less complicated. Also, relationships with faculty members and adults can better thrive in these multiple settings, creating learning and mentorship opportunities that are hard to come by in other environments.
